Pros

Salary was average for the position--better than I thought it would be

Cons

Healthtrust/CHS and HCA all intermingled for the hiring process, and they were very disorganized and unprofessional. HealthTrust uses HCA's HR & benefits but doesn't really have authority over HCA, so it seems there are communication problems between them and what seems like bickering. But worse then that, they made the offer verbally and provided the salary but wouldn't answer question about pto--she said she'd email that; now I see why! They only give two weeks pto, which is way out of date! And when I tried to negotiate it, they got visibly annoyed--just all kinds of ways unprofessional! Obvious they are just looking for bodies--don't care about individuals!

Pros

Work life balance is good Healthcare benefits is good

Cons

Travel is a difficult area to work in. It's very cliquey. They "want you to be promoted to recruiter" but heavily misrepresent the position, requirements, and pay. They like to say that you will make 6-figures within your first year, but you will not. Not unless you eat, sleep, and breathe HealthTrust. Keep in mind that while you may do okay, what you make is dependent on who you sign and HCA Healthcare has a terrible reputation in the medical world when it comes to employee treatment and environment. If you LIKE sales and do well in sales, this actually might be for you. You're pitching dreams, not promises, to get a bite on a line and try to get commissions. It's going to be draining. It's going to be tough. It's going to be competitive. There are other travel agencies who treat employees better. If you're interviewing and they promised you greatness, prepare yourself not to get it.
